Arsenal 'monitoring Stuttgart midfielder'

Arsenal are reportedly contemplating a move for Stuttgart midfielder Orel Mangala during one of the upcoming transfer windows.

Stuttgart midfielder Orel Mangala has reportedly emerged as a potential transfer target for Arsenal.

With Granit Xhaka currently out of favour and Lucas Torreira allegedly unsettled in North London, Unai Emery has been left to consider potential replacements.

According to HLN, Mangala has been placed on the club's shortlist of possible incomings for January or next summer.

The 21-year-old has been a regular for Stuttgart this season, with seven starts and four substitute outings coming in Germany's second tier.

However, it is claimed that Lille, Lyon, Marseille and Roma are also monitoring the development of the Belgium Under-21 international, who could cost as much as £26m.
